vscode中markdown一些插件用不了解决方式
我发现我安装了vscode的一些插件,但是没起效果(就是该插件暗淡了),后面得知,是因为没有信任工作空间。
This extension has been disabled because the current workspace is not trusted
这个提示信息表明,由于当前工作区未被信任,Markdown Preview Enhanced 扩展被禁用了。在 VS Code 里,为了保证安全性,若工作区未被信任,部分扩展会被禁用。下面为你介绍几种解决办法:
信任当前工作区
你可以把当前工作区标记为受信任的,这样就能启用扩展。具体步骤如下:
- 点击 VS Code 窗口左下角的黄色盾牌图标,或者在命令面板(按下
Ctrl + Shift + P
或者Cmd + Shift + P
)中输入 “Manage Workspace Trust” 并回车。 - 在弹出的菜单中,选择 “Trust this workspace”。
更改信任设置
要是你不想信任这个工作区,不过又希望启用扩展,可以调整 VS Code 的信任设置。具体步骤如下:
- 打开命令面板(按下
Ctrl + Shift + P
或者Cmd + Shift + P
),输入 “Settings: Open Settings (JSON)” 并回车,这会打开settings.json
文件。 - 在
settings.json
文件里添加或者修改以下设置:
"security.workspace.trust.enabled": false
这样做会关闭工作区信任功能,所有扩展都能在任何工作区使用。不过要注意,这会带来一定的安全风险,因为未受信任的工作区里的代码可能会执行恶意操作。
在安全模式下重新加载
你还可以尝试在安全模式下重新加载 VS Code,然后再次信任工作区:
- 打开命令面板(按下
Ctrl + Shift + P
或者Cmd + Shift + P
)。 - 输入 “Reload Window in Safe Mode” 并回车。
- 重新信任工作区(操作方法同 “信任当前工作区”)。
通过上述方法,你应该能够解决由于工作区未被信任导致扩展被禁用的问题。